[0033] The definition of the magnetic circuit structure of the transformer of the present invention is different from that of the traditional transformer and must be defined separately.
[0034] In the present invention:
[0035] Core (1): Only refers to the magnetic device in the winding.
[0036] Winding (2): Refers to the electrical chain of the transformer, which is the device through which the alternating current of the transformer enters and flows out.
[0037] Iron yoke (3): Refers to the magnetic device in the transformer that connects the magnetic currents in the iron core to each other and completes the circuit.
[0038] Magnetic circuit: Refers to the flux linkage of the transformer, which is the general term for the entire magnet of the transformer, including the iron core and iron yoke.
[0039] In a traditional transformer:
[0040] Core: also called core, core column, core column, which is equivalent to the iron core (1) of the present invention.
